Hi, I found out I had uterus didelphys when I was 20. I tried tampons and it never worked. I've always had very painful periods and very heavy. I have 2 children who were premature and I was watched very closely with high risk doctors. In the last couple of years I've notice my period getting heavier and longer and more painful. My Gyno was giving me birth control which I couldn't tolerate. Then gave me a medication to help with heavy bleeding and lessen pain and did nothing. I've tried heating pads and Motrin, which helps a little but my cramps start 3 days early then my period is 7 days and then it slowly tapers off so it's about 11 or 12 days of misery. My Gyno referred me to a pain specialist and he said he couldn't help me and referred me to a urogynocologist which said they could help? My GYNO was giving me pain medicine and decided after several month he didn't want to but it actual helped where I could take care of my children and was able to work but I just don't know what to do. Is a partial hysterectomy my only chose? I'm just so depressed about it. Any suggestions I would appreciate it. Post a CommentOops!The words you entered did not match the given text.
